4. Phone Camera Settings

Camera Tips

  • Make sure your camera lens is clean of any smudges or dirt

  • Disable calls and notifications (set to: do not disturb)

  • Make sure video recording is set to (1080P/FHD at 30 fps)

  • Make sure you have plenty of hard drive space available (3+ GB)

Framing

  • Position yourself an arm's length from your phone

  • Ensure your phone is secured horizontally

  • Use the front-facing camera to record

  • Center yourself in the frame (looking straight at the camera)

  • Camera should be placed at eye-level

  • Your head should be near the top with some room to spare

5. Video Tips & Preparation

Lighting

  • Use a room with plenty of natural light (indirect sunlight)

  • Supplement natural light with ring light and lamps

  • Give yourself a few feet of space from any walls

  • Avoid harsh shadows or direct sunrays

  • Avoid bright overhead lights

  • DO NOT sit with a bright window behind you

Background

  • Minimize any noise or distractions (fans, AC units, kids, pets, etc.)

  • Record in room that is clean, tidy, and uncluttered

  • Avoid very large or very small confined spaces

Clothing

  • Simple solid (warm) colored clothing is best

  • Wear clothing that is comfortable

  • Jewelry is fine, but keep to a minimum

  • Avoid clothing with patterns, stripes, and plaid

  • Avoid all white or all black clothing

  • No hats or anything that obstructs your face
